Southlands Foundation
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 914,793 | 928,555 | −13,762 | 49.4 | 36% |
| 2012 | 1,320,987 | 893,307 | 427,680 | 59.0 | 37% |
| 2013 | 1,040,262 | 952,851 | 87,411 | 59.9 | 38% |
| 2014 | 1,344,370 | 1,002,020 | 342,350 | 58.8 | 38% |
| 2015 | 1,024,862 | 1,021,960 | 2,902 | 55.8 | 38% |
| 2016 | 1,302,135 | 1,082,920 | 219,215 | 54.4 | 40% |
| 2017 | 1,007,681 | 1,125,713 | −118,032 | 53.4 | 38% |
| 2018 | 909,435 | 1,024,274 | −114,839 | 54.3 | 37% |
| 2019 | 873,178 | 1,074,642 | −201,464 | 53.1 | 38% |
| 2020 | 992,551 | 977,515 | 15,036 | 62.3 | 39% |
| 2021 | 1,088,998 | 1,038,876 | 50,122 | 60.9 | 33% |
| 2022 | 884,888 | 1,060,548 | −175,660 | 51.4 | 35% |
| 2023 | 938,358 | 1,018,211 | −79,853 | 55.2 | 39%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$79,853 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 55.2 months of spending, up from 49.4 in 2011. Staff pay was 39% of spending. $96,102 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
